17.02.2022 Extra For Reporting to the Press, Ogun Police PRO Detains Man Defrauded by His Friend

Published 17th Feb, 2022

By Yakubu Mohammed

Abimbola Oyeyemi, the Ogun State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O), has again detained Shokunbi Damilola, a man defrauded by Mohammed Seedu, a car dealer in Abeokuta.

Oyeyemi said he would not release his detainee until our reporter showed up in Ogun State.

Damilola was invited by the PPRO on Wednesday after FIJ’s story revealing how Seedu, Oyeyemi’s friend, defrauded him.

Oyeyemi was angry he reported the case to the press. In an audio recording obtained by FIJ on Thursday, the PPRO was heard cursing Damilola and swearing to destroy his life.

Damilola managed to inform FIJ the PPRO had detained him. Insiders at Eleweran Police Station also confirmed the incident to FIJ.

The PPRO was said to be protecting Seedu, who collected N3 million from Damilola to get him a vehicle from Cotonou in 2021 but returned with neither the money nor a vehicle.

Following the story, Oyeyemi denied knowing Damilola. However, FIJ has an audio of the PPRO appealing to Damilola on Seedu’s behalf.
